skinflint

noun
/ˈskɪnˌflɪnt/

Meaning

a person who spends as little money as possible; a miser

Example Sentences

The landlord was such a skinflint that he never repaired anything.

Synonyms

miser, cheapskate, penny-pincher, tightwad

Antonyms

spender, philanthropist

Collocations

old skinflint, miserly skinflint, stingy skinflint
